Output 34ccaa02b106426a69e78c19f9234c18a9cd73bb94044ddf1fef8c25f2a2c533:0

value
3500
script pubkey
OP_0 OP_PUSHBYTES_20 ddadea507614f94e24b7e62c523bc00e8c5056ad
address
ltc1qmkk755rkznu5uf9huck9yw7qp6x9q44d295dge
transaction
34ccaa02b106426a69e78c19f9234c18a9cd73bb94044ddf1fef8c25f2a2c533
spent
true